Disagree somewhat. I think teams playing slow careful footy struggle against us because it gives us time to set up down back and inevitably leads to slow I50 entries.

We are vulnerable against attacking running sides that carry the ball by hand from half back direct through the middle. See Port this year and Essendon 2018.

Don’t think we will lose to Carlton but it won’t be because they play attacking rather than defensive
All depends how clean they are. The Port and Essendon games worked because they rarely messed up disposals coming through the middle. Our two weaknesses are fast clean ball movement down the corridor and parking the bus (could make an argument that both of those are true for just about every side in the comp). Part of the reason we also has Richmond’s measure last year, as their game plan is intentionally messy which plays into our hands.

If they try to open the game up but are off slightly, we have the ability to cut them up with quick movement by foot the other way (far quicker than any run and carry). Same could be said for any side really, if you’re not clean against us and we show up that day, goodluck to you.

The last few times Carlton have played us they have gone the full stem the bleeding, ultra negative football, which hasn't allowed them to win, but it has made the scores uncomfortably close.

Teague has them playing attacking football with a freedom to their style. Thats great for Carlton until now. Because playing free and attacking football against the Eagles is a terrible idea.

If we bring the right attitude we should blow them away, as our game plan favors us. I can see us punishing them on turnovers and bombs into their forward fifty. They will then lose confidence quickly and we can smash them.

If we allow them to get going early however, they will have their tails up and will take us on ferociously.
